My heating or cooling system will not turn on at all. Put the thermostat into the OFF mode. Remove the batteries (if equipped) and press the reset button located on the front of the thermostat. Replace the batteries and move the system switch to the HEAT or COOL position and try running your heating or cooling system again.Check that the fan control switch is in the AUTO position. This will allow the fan to run only when the heating or cooling system is turned on and running. Once you’ve reached the desired temperature, release the “Set” button.Canceling Overrides To cancel either a temporary or permanent override, press the "Run" button. This will revert the thermostat back to the temperature programmed for the current scheduled period. The word "Hold" will disappear from the screen. The temperature sensed by the thermostat is higher than the 99° F (37° C) upper limit of the thermostat's display range. The display will return to normal after the sensed temperature lowers within the 40° to 99° F (4° to 37° C) display range. The lock icon will display on the ... rheem water softner After my air conditioning turns off my fan runs an additional minute or two. Many Braeburn thermostats include a feature called Residual Cooling Fan Delay. This feature allows the fan to run 0, 30, 60 or 90 more seconds after your cooling compressor turns off.
